Soft and Stylish Scarves
Although bouclé yarn might seem delicate, it’s perfect for creating soft and stylish scarves that add texture and warmth to any outfit.
When you knit or crochet with bouclé, you get a unique looped surface that feels cozy against your skin. You’ll love how easy it’s to work with this yarn—it hides small mistakes and creates a beautiful, tactile fabric.
Choose simple stitch patterns like garter or stockinette to let the yarn’s natural texture shine. Plus, scarves made from lightweight bouclé won’t feel bulky, so you can wear them comfortably in various seasons.
Whether you prefer a classic rectangular scarf or a trendy infinity loop, this yarn helps you make pieces that feel both luxurious and casual.

Stylish Pattern Choices
The soft, textured feel of bouclé yarn lends itself beautifully to a variety of stylish shawl patterns that highlight its unique loops and lightweight warmth.
When choosing patterns, opt for simple stitches like garter or stockinette that let the yarn’s texture shine without overwhelming it. Lace patterns with larger holes can add elegance while maintaining breathability.
You might also try asymmetrical or triangular shawls, which show off bouclé’s drape and texture well. Avoid overly intricate stitch work; the yarn’s natural bulk can obscure fine detail.
Instead, focus on designs that enhance bouclé’s cozy, tactile qualities. By selecting the right pattern, you’ll create a shawl that’s not only comfortable but also a standout accessory that showcases bouclé’s charm and style.

Simple Stitch Patterns
When working with lightweight bouclé yarn, choosing simple stitch patterns can enhance the natural texture without overwhelming it. For textured baby blankets, stick to basic stitches like garter stitch, seed stitch, or simple ribbing.
These patterns allow the bouclé’s loops and curls to stand out, creating a cozy, tactile surface that’s gentle for delicate skin. Avoid intricate lace or cable patterns, as they can get lost in the yarn’s unique texture.
Instead, focus on stitches that add subtle dimension and keep the blanket soft and flexible. By using straightforward stitches, you’ll highlight the yarn’s beauty and make your project easier to work on.
This approach guarantees your baby blanket looks charming while remaining durable and comfortable.

Frequently Asked Questions
How Do I Care for and Wash Lightweight Bouclé Yarn Items?
You should hand wash your lightweight bouclé yarn items gently in cold water with mild detergent. Avoid wringing; instead, press out water and lay them flat to dry. This keeps their texture soft and intact.
Can Lightweight Bouclé Yarn Be Machine Washed?
Like tiptoeing on a delicate dance floor, you shouldn’t machine wash lightweight bouclé yarn—it can snag or stretch. Instead, hand wash gently in cool water to keep your cozy creation looking flawless and fresh.
What Knitting Needles or Crochet Hooks Work Best With Bouclé Yarn?
You’ll want to use larger needles or hooks, like size 8-10 (5-6 mm), to let bouclé’s texture shine and prevent tight stitches. Bamboo or wooden tools work well, giving better grip and control.
How Do I Prevent Bouclé Yarn From Snagging During Knitting?
You can prevent bouclé yarn from snagging by using smooth, polished needles or hooks and working slowly. Keep your stitches loose, avoid pulling too tight, and handle the yarn gently to maintain its texture and avoid snags.
Is Lightweight Bouclé Yarn Suitable for Summer Garments?
Yes, lightweight bouclé yarn can work for summer garments since it’s breathable and textured. You’ll want to pick open, airy patterns to keep things cool and comfortable while showing off bouclé’s unique look.
